On Ashland Avenue by HarryT
    Childhood Contest Winner 

Four of us lived in a three room place
Prettied up by windows hung with lace
Living room had a convertible couch
Made up, it looked like a kangaroo’s pouch
Bedroom was for Mom and Dad
Time out area if we did something bad
 
Apartment was on the second floor
Bakery below at 6 AM opened its door
At 4 AM the wafting of fresh baking bread
By 5 AM my bro and I were out of our bed
 
Summer, roll away beds on the back porch
No pajamas, just slept in tee-shirts and shorts
On really hot nights we rolled our beds outside
On the walled-in deck, we slept side by side
We would talk and watch the darkening night sky
Moon rising high, night birds flying, as clouds rolled by
 
We left the place when I was in first grade
Memories from there that I wouldn’t trade
